What is an Exhaust Hose Clamp?


An exhaust hose clamp is a device used to secure and seal exhaust hoses, ensuring that gases and fumes do not leak into the environment or the interior of a vehicle. These clamps come in various sizes and designs, tailored for different applications, including automotive, marine, and industrial exhaust systems. The effectiveness of exhaust systems largely hinges on the quality and reliability of these clamps, making their production critical.

Manufacturing Processes


The manufacturing process of exhaust hose clamps typically involves several key stages


1. Material Selection High-grade materials such as stainless steel, carbon steel, or polymer composites are often chosen for their durability, resistance to corrosion, and ability to withstand extreme temperatures.


2. Design and Engineering Engineers design clamps based on specific requirements such as size, load capacity, and application environment. Computer-aided design (CAD) software is often used to create detailed models.

3. Fabrication The selected materials undergo processes such as cutting, bending, and welding to form the basic structure of the clamps. Automated machinery enhances precision and efficiency during this phase.


4. Coating and Finishing To further improve durability, clamps may be coated with materials like zinc or powder coating to enhance resistance against rust and wear.


5. Quality Assurance Finished products are subjected to rigorous testing to ensure they meet safety and performance standards. This may involve stress tests, corrosion tests, and dimensional inspections.


6. Packaging and Distribution Once approved, the clamps are packaged for shipment to automotive manufacturers, repair shops, and industrial clients.


Importance of Quality Control


Quality control is paramount in exhaust hose clamp manufacturing. A failure in these clamps can lead to significant safety issues, loss of efficiency, and environmental hazards. Therefore, factories often implement ISO certification processes and adhere to international standards, bolstering their reputation in the industry.
